What are the responsibilities and job description for the Credentialing Specialist position at Sherman MD Providers Inc?
Overview: The Credentialing Specialist will verify the accuracy and validity of healthcare professionals' credentials, licenses, and certifications, ensuring compliance with regulatory and organizational standards. This role is essential to maintaining the integrity of our healthcare team and ensuring that all professionals meet the necessary qualifications to provide safe and effective care.
Job Description: Under the direction of supervisor, the credentialing specialist is responsible for coordinating all aspects of the credentialing and recredentialing process as well as changes in privileges specialty or demographic information for healthcare professionals practicing within the organization. Responsible for monitoring and managing credentials/recredentialing requirements to ensure the collection of all required renewals are on file within their required time frame.
Key Responsibilities:
- Credentialing specialist, meticulously reviews, and verify the educational background, licenses, certifications, and work experience of healthcare providers. Conduct primary source verification, contacting educational institutions, licensing boards, and previous employers to validate information.
- Perform background checks, including criminal record checks to identify potential risk or red flags. Ensure that the healthcare providers meet the necessary qualifications and comply with industry, standards and regulatory requirements. Maintain accurate and up-to-date records for healthcare professionals' credentials. Advise staff members on renewal dates for licenses and credentials to help ensure that they can continue to work legally without lapses.
- Specialists must often maintain large databases containing confidential employee information. Timely entry processing and tracking of credentialing files. Uphold and ensure compliance confidentiality and adhere to all HIPAA guidelines and maintain a strict level of confidentiality for all company policies and procedures, departmental and healthcare provider information as well as the overall mission and values of the organization. Assist with credentialing audits.
- Ensure all tasks duties comply with all regulatory and accreditation standards including, The Joint Commission and the National committee Quality Assurance (NCQA) guidelines.
- Reports any issue in a timely manner to manger, to ensure decision making in accordance with the credentialing and privilege policy and federal state, local and government and health plans standards.
- Communicates clearly with supervisor and with providers, their credentialing representatives and leadership, as needed to provide timely updates and responses on a day-to-day credentialing and privileged issues as they arise.
- Perform other job-related duties as assigned
Qualifications:
- High school Diploma or higher- Required
- Certified Provider credentialing specialist ( CPCS) Required
- 1-3 years of previous employment as a credentialing specialist- Required
- Certified Professional Medical Services Management(CPMSM) - Preferred
- Previous experience creating databases and/or inputting data (data entry)
- Knowledge of federal and state regulatory agencies and accrediting bodies(CMS,TJC,NCQA,etc)
- CPR/BLS -Required
